Start Here
Quintessa delivers signed, pre-screened motor vehicle accident retainers to personal injury law firms. We do not sell shared leads.
New partnerships begin at a minimum monthly investment of $25,000, with many strategic clients launching at approximately $75,000 per month. Some partner firms have grown to $750,000 per month in a single market, and several invest more than $1 million per month across multiple markets.
We are hiring a Director of Growth to lead the teams responsible for acquiring, retaining, and expanding those partnerships.
You will directly manage:
- Enterprise Growth Executives responsible for sourcing and closing new law firm partnerships
- Growth Managers responsible for retaining and expanding existing client relationships
This is a hands-on commercial leadership role. You will own new revenue, retained revenue, and expansion revenue while coaching the people responsible for each.

About Quintessa
Quintessa Marketing is a high-performance marketing and intake company supporting personal injury law firms nationwide.
Since 2016, Quintessa has delivered more than 100,000 motor vehicle retainers and achieved sustained double- and triple-digit year-over-year growth. We are building toward a billion-dollar future with a team that values performance, ownership, and impact.
Fifty percent of Quintessa’s profits are donated to charities, schools, and nonprofit organizations.
